The Regulatory Environment and Impact on Bonus Offerings
Canadian online gambling regulation is decentralized, with each province establishing its own framework. Ontario, for instance, launched its regulated iGaming market in 2022, which includes strict guidelines on bonus advertising and wagering requirements. These regulations aim to protect consumers while promoting industry integrity.
Furthermore, recent policy discussions consider capping bonus sizes and imposing wagering requirements to mitigate potential problem gambling. Industry experts increasingly recognize that responsible gaming initiatives are integral to sustainable bonus strategies, which in turn reinforce gambling credibility and consumer trust.

Introducing Innovative Bonus Mechanics
To stand out in a crowded market, operators are deploying novel bonus mechanics, such as:
- Micro-bonuses: Small, frequent rewards that encourage regular play.
- Gamified Rewards: Interactive challenges that integrate bonus offerings with gameplay experience.
- Cryptocurrency Bonuses: Leveraging digital assets to attract tech-savvy demographics.
